Abstract
The invention discloses a medical waste classifying and storing system based on voice recognition; the system comprises a control module, wherein the control module is electrically connected with a storage module, a storage box, a voice module, an auxiliary module, an adjusting module and a wireless sending module, the adjusting module is electrically connected with a municipal power grid, the wireless sending module is in wireless communication connection with a wireless receiving module, and the wireless receiving module is electrically connected with a cloud server; the voice input microphone in the voice module receives the voice command, the voice content is recognized and processed through the voice recognition unit and the voice processing unit, the voice command is transmitted to the control module, the control module controls and adjusts the storage box, the disinfection system is arranged in the storage box to disinfect waste in the storage box, the wireless transmission module is arranged to transmit remote information of the storage box, and the storage box is convenient to clean.

Background
Hospital waste refers to all waste that a hospital needs to discard and cannot be reused, and includes biological and non-biological, and also includes domestic garbage. Medical waste refers to waste generated during activities such as diagnosis, treatment and nursing of patients, and the medical waste may contain a large amount of pathogenic microorganisms and harmful chemical substances, and even radioactive and damaging substances, so the medical waste is an important risk factor causing disease transmission or related public health problems, and therefore, when the medical waste is discarded, the medical waste needs to be treated by classification, disinfection and the like, but various medical waste storage systems on the market still have various problems.
Although the medical waste classification storage system based on voice recognition disclosed in the publication No. CN110217507A realizes complicated classification rules of medical waste, and further frequently causes classification errors, thereby increasing the workload of subsequent processing, the system does not solve the problems that different storage boxes still need to be manually opened when the existing medical waste is classified and stored, the storage boxes cannot be automatically opened through voice, and the storage boxes cannot be sterilized and remotely transmitted, and the like.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ments. All other embodiments, which can be derived by a person skilled in the art from the embodiments given herein without making any creative effort, shall fall within the protection scope of the present invention.
Referring to fig. 1-4, the present invention provides a technical solution: a medical waste classifying and storing system based on voice recognition comprises a control module, wherein the control module is electrically connected with a storage module, a storing box, a voice module, an auxiliary module, an adjusting module and a wireless sending module, the adjusting module is electrically connected with a municipal power grid, the wireless sending module is in wireless communication connection with a wireless receiving module, and the wireless receiving module is electrically connected with a cloud server;
the auxiliary module is internally provided with a system control switch, a system display and a system buzzer, wherein the system switch is used for controlling the on-off of the voltage of the system, the system display is used for displaying the data of the system, and the system buzzer is used for playing the system voice;
the voice module comprises a voice input microphone, a voice recognition unit and a voice processing unit, wherein the voice input microphone is used for receiving an external voice command, the voice recognition unit is used for analyzing and understanding semantics of the voice command received by the voice input microphone, and the voice processing unit is used for filtering, amplifying and converting the voice command;
the storage box comprises a driver, a power motor and a disinfection system, the driver drives the power motor when receiving an information instruction sent by the control module, the output end of the power motor is movably connected with a storage box cover, the power motor is used for controlling and adjusting the opening and closing of the storage box cover, and the disinfection system is used for disinfecting and sterilizing medical wastes in the storage box;
the utility grid is used for supplying power to the system, and the adjusting module is used for adjusting the voltage of the utility grid, so that the voltage of the utility grid can be used for the control module;
the wireless sending module is used for transmitting the information of the medical waste storage box to the cloud server, so that the cloud server can send cleaning personnel to clean the medical waste storage box in time, and bacteria in the medical waste storage box are prevented from being massively propagated;
the storage module is used for storing an operation program body of the system, and the system display screen is used for inputting information of the medical waste stored in the storage box and storing the stored information of the medical waste into the storage module;
when the system is used, the system is opened through a system switch on the auxiliary module, so that the system can be supplied by a municipal power grid, a voltage reduction module in the adjusting module reduces high voltage into low voltage, the rectifying module converts alternating current voltage into direct current voltage, the voltage stabilizing module and the filtering module realize stable voltage transmission to the control module, then a voice input microphone in the voice module receives an external voice command and transmits the voice command to the voice recognition unit and the voice processing unit, so that the voice module can understand the meaning of the voice command and process and adjust the voice, and then the voice command is transmitted to the control module, the control module transmits the voice command to a driver in the storage box, the driver starts the power motor, so that the power motor can drive the storage box cover to be opened, and then medical wastes are put into the storage box, then close and deposit the case lid, after closing and depositing the case lid, disinfection system can disinfect to the medical waste who deposits incasement portion to when assigning voice command, still need save the kind of medical waste and deposit people's information through the system display screen on the auxiliary module, convenient record.
In order to reduce the utility grid and convert the utility grid into a dc voltage for the control module to use, in this embodiment, preferably, a voltage reduction module, a rectification module, a voltage stabilization module and a filtering module are arranged in the regulation module, the voltage reduction module adopts an RC voltage reduction circuit, and the rectification module adopts an MOS transistor bridge rectifier circuit.
In order to enable the information that the system needs to store to be stored separately and not to cause confusion to the system, in this embodiment, it is preferable that the storage module includes a ROM storage module and a RAM storage module, the ROM storage module is used for storing a program body operated by the system, and the RAM storage module is used for storing a storage record of the medical waste.
In order to realize the classified storage of the medical wastes without causing the messy storage of the medical wastes, in this embodiment, it is preferable that the storage boxes are at least provided with five groups, and at least five groups of the storage boxes are respectively an infectious waste storage box, a pathological waste storage box, an injury waste storage box, a pharmaceutical waste storage box and a chemical waste storage box.
In order to sterilize the medical waste inside the storage box, in this embodiment, it is preferable that the sterilization system includes an ultraviolet lamp and a 84 sterilizing liquid, the ultraviolet lamp is fixedly installed at the bottom of the storage box cover, and a spray header of the 84 sterilizing liquid is also fixed at the bottom of the storage box cover.
In order to enable the storage box to detect the weight and to send a cleaning instruction when the medical waste inside the storage box reaches a certain degree, in this embodiment, it is preferable that a weight sensor is fixedly arranged at the bottom of the storage box, and the weight sensor is used for detecting the weight inside the storage box.
In order to receive, process and adjust the voice command, in this embodiment, preferably, the voice input microphone is electrically connected to the voice recognition unit, the voice recognition unit is electrically connected to the voice processing unit, and the voice processing unit is electrically connected to the control module.
In order to realize the control and adjustment of the storage boxes of each group, in this embodiment, preferably, the control module is electrically connected to the driver, the driver is electrically connected to the power motor, and the driver and the power motor are respectively and fixedly arranged in at least five groups of the storage boxes.
The working principle and the using process of the invention are as follows: when the system is used, the system is opened through a system switch on the auxiliary module, so that the system can be supplied by a municipal power grid, a voltage reduction module in the adjusting module reduces high voltage into low voltage, the rectifying module converts alternating current voltage into direct current voltage, the voltage stabilizing module and the filtering module realize stable voltage transmission to the control module, then a voice input microphone in the voice module receives an external voice command and transmits the voice command to the voice recognition unit and the voice processing unit, so that the voice module can understand the meaning of the voice command and process and adjust the voice, and then the voice command is transmitted to the control module, the control module transmits the voice command to a driver in the storage box, the driver starts the power motor, so that the power motor can drive the storage box cover to be opened, and then medical wastes are put into the storage box, then close and deposit the case lid, after closing and depositing the case lid, disinfection system can disinfect to the medical waste who deposits incasement portion to when assigning voice command, still need save the kind of medical waste and deposit people's information through the system display screen on the auxiliary module, convenient record.
